tl;dr: Hannity had three American couples on his show to share their "horror stories" about ObamaCare and how they are suffering under the new law. Salon reporter decides to do his own follow-up, calls each of the families, discovers that their stories were based on ignorance and fear of the new law; none of them had even tried to enroll or research their options. The reporter put their information into healthcare.gov and found that all of them would be better off under ACA.
